  • PFAS – A threat for groundwater and drinking water supply in Sweden?

    • Perfluoroalkyl substances (PFAS) are a group of anthropogenic environmental pollutants that are widely distributed in the global environment. They have multiple industrial uses, including water repellents in clothing, paper coatings and firefighting foam. According to a study released by the Environmental Directorate of the OECD, they are persistent, bioaccumulative and toxic to mammalian species (OECD, 2002). In some municipal drinking water wells in Sweden, measured concentrations of PFAS found to be several hundred times higher than the allowed threshold values. This has created a huge public concern and has recently attracted much media attention in Sweden (e.g. Afzelius et al., 2014; Bergman et al., 2014; Lewis et al., 2014). PFAS findings raised questions such as “What can we do to solve the problem?” When it comes to drinking water, there are a number of techniques that can ensure that PFAS levels are reduced to acceptable levels. This may be a costly challenge, but from a technical point of view it is possible. To ensure the safety of drinking water from a public health perspective is obviously a top priority. However, international experience shows that the cost of cleaning up PFAS in groundwater may be significantly higher than continuously treat drinking water in water works. Approximately fifty percent of Sweden’s drinking water comes from groundwater. As a result, there are several ongoing and planned PFAS-related environmental and drinking-water investigations in Sweden. Many aquifers that supply municipal water plants are located in areas of sand and gravel deposits. Such soils have relatively high permeabilities, which permits extraction of large volumes of water. However, the downside to high permeabilities is that they also allow dissolved contaminants as PFAS to spread over large areas. If one disregards the health risks linked to its presence in drinking water, PFAS have an impact on three of Sweden’s national environmental quality objectives, namely, A Non-Toxic Environment, Flourishing Lakes and Streams and Good-Quality Groundwater. Although the survey of PFAS in our groundwater supplies will take time, it is feasible. Much research in the field of hydrogeology and geochemistry remains before a viable and cost-effective groundwater remediation method can be operational. Until then, it is essential that measures are taken to identify the present distribution and magnitude of PFAS in groundwater and prevents its further spread in our most important aquifers.   • Personalising service user engagement : entrepreneurs and membership organisations in the mental health sector

    • New modes of social mobilisation are emerging in the mental health sector. Member-based mental health service user organisations (MHSUOs), targeting people with lived experience of mental ill-health and occasionally their relatives, have been active in Sweden since the 1960s. Today, broader developments towards personalisation of politics are visible in the area, exemplified by the phenomenon ‘service user entrepreneurs’ (SUEs). These are individuals with lived experience of mental ill-health, channelling their engagement through businesses they have established and typically using social media to build networks around their causes.The overall aim of this thesis is to contribute to the understanding of service user engagement in the mental health sector, as it is expressed through collective and personalised forms of mobilisation. More specifically, I will examine the expressions of and the dynamic between member-based MHSUOs and network-based SUEs.The thesis consists of four sub-studies: Study I is an international narrative literature review that analyses the role of and challenges facing MHSUOs. Study II is a document study focused on mapping Swedish MHSUOs in relation to their activities and relationships. Through case study methodology, study III examines the communication of SUEs, specifically attending to how they establish authority. Based on interviews with SUEs and representatives of MHSUOs, study IV explores how these groups regard the role of experiential knowledge for their endeavours.In the thesis I discuss how professionalisation and hybridisation processes are seen in Swedish MHSUOs. These organisations engage in advocacy but also educational activities, and provide experiential knowledge as a service to external actors. MHSUOs typically have close collaborations with public authorities. Such collaborations have political potential, by giving service user groups the ability to contribute to policy development. However, there are also associated risks of tokenism and co-optation. Maintaining and investing in more autonomous spaces to meet and develop alternative perspectives, would be a strategy for MHSUOs to protect their independence. I further discuss how the emergence of SUEs is typical of broader trends in social mobilisation towards the use of social media and a focus on personal narratives. The phenomenon SUE distinctively illustrates a broader social surge for publicised accounts of vulnerability that can be capitalised on. The analysis identifies personal narratives, mobilisation of collectives and institutional perspectives as sources of authority drawn upon in the SUEs’ communication.Furthermore, the results show that SUEs and MHSUOs have witnessed increased demand for their experiential knowledge. Experiential knowledge can be articulated through personal narratives of individual experience, but also as a form of knowledge that originates in collectively deliberated experiences. These different articulations have distinct political potential. However, it is important to clarify what kind of experiential knowledge and representativeness that is required in different arenas.

  • Elevated levels of VCA0117 in response to external signals activates type VI secretion in Vibrio cholerae A1552

    • The type VI nanomachine is critical for Vibrio cholerae to establish infections and to thrive in niches co‐occupied by competing bacteria. The genes for the type VI structural proteins are encoded in one large and two small auxiliary gene clusters. VCA0117 (VasH) – a σ54‐transcriptional activator – is strictly required for functionality of the type VI secretion system since it controls production of the structural protein Hcp. While some strains constitutively produce a functional system, others do not and require specific growth conditions of low temperature and high osmolarity for expression of the type VI machinery. Here, we trace integration of these regulatory signals to the promoter activity of the large gene cluster in which many components of the machinery and VCA0117 itself are encoded. Using in vivo and in vitro assays and variants of VCA0117, we show that activation of the σ54‐promoters of the auxiliary gene clusters by elevated VCA0117 levels are all that is required to overcome the need for specialized growth conditions. We propose a model in which signal integration via the large operon promoter directs otherwise restrictive levels of VCA0117 that ultimately dictates a sufficient supply of Hcp for completion of a functional type VI secretion system.

  • Satellite remote sensing of primary production in semi-arid Africa

    • With the challenges Africa faces with respect to the predicted warming due to climate change, the continents role in the global carbon cycle has been increasingly recognized. Earth observing satellites have played a significant role in the study of vegetation, particularly in Africa where climate stations are sparse. Satellite data can provide the means to map plant primary production for monitoring of food and grazing resources and to elucidate the role of African regions in the global carbon cycle. In this thesis, remote sensing based methods for large area estimation of primary production have been evaluated, primarily in semi-arid African ecosystems, by using the light use efficiency concept. Furthermore, the degree to which environmental driving forces account for a satellite observed greening trend in the African Sahel (a semi-arid region located between the Sahara and the more tropical areas to the south) from 1982 to 1998 was investigated by using a dynamic global vegetation model (DGVM). The DGVM simulations re-enforce the hypothesis that the greening as observed by satellites is related to rainfall. Although this suggests that an increase in rainfall is the dominant causative factor of the greening, the analysis was based on aggregated data. Finer observations from the moderate resolution imaging spectroradiometer (MODIS) may be used to provide more detailed measures of primary production. An overall relationship was found between eddy covariance gross primary production (GPP, the total amount of carbon assimilated through photosynthesis by plants) and the MODIS enhanced vegetation index (EVI). However, the incorporation of measurements of photosynthetically active radiation (PAR), and a water availability factor to EVI improved relationships with eddy covariance GPP. Site specific relationships to GPP with all of these variables included were found to be explained by peak leaf area index (LAI) and long-term mean annual rainfall. In addition, the MODIS GPP model was evaluated over African sites. This model estimates GPP according to the light use efficiency approach and assumes a fixed maximum rate of carbon assimilated per unit PAR absorbed (epsilon max) for different biomes. MODIS GPP correlated well with eddy covariance GPP for some sites and seasonality was generally well captured. However, GPP was underestimated for the drier sites. The underestimations were concluded to be mainly due to low values of epsilon max but can also be due to the linear interpolation of fraction of absorbed photosynthetically active radiation (FAPAR) across unreliable values. Continued efforts of land surface validation are needed to improve models driven by satellite data over semi-arid ecosystems. To better link estimates of carbon with reflectance properties, installation of radiometric instruments at eddy covariance sites would be beneficial.

  • SAFE MULTIBYGG, Slutrapport Riskidentifiering, analys och åtgärdsmetodik för olycksförebyggande arbete för multifunktionella byggnader med avseende på specifika antagonistiska hot

    • Multifunktionella byggnader karaktäriseras av att flera olika funktioner (verksamheter) finns inom en och samma byggnad. Ofta är några av funktionerna att betrakta som samhällsviktiga. Brandskyddet i sådana byggnader är av största vikt med hänsyn till att ett stort antal personer kan befinna sig i byggnaden samtidigt som en brand skulle kunna orsaka förlust av samhällsviktiga funktioner. Vidare har det i samhället skett en ökning av antagonistiska attacker. I forskningsprojektet SAFE MULTIBYGG har ett helhetsgrepp tagits över den problematik som finns avseende brandskydd och antagonistiska hot i multifunktionella byggnader. Denna rapport utgör en sammanfattande slutrapport för forskningsprojektet och summerar resultaten av ingående arbetspaket. Projektet har finansierats av MSB, Myndigheten för samhällsskydd och beredskap. Projektet inleddes 2011 och avslutades i december 2013
